>>Also sprach Daniel Myers:
>>>"Item, you can tell the age of a hare from the number of openings under
>>>its tail, for there will be as many openings as years."
>>>Le Menagier de Paris (Janet Hinson, trans.)

>>Or, is this perhaps a little practical joke, a la Margaret Meade, played
>>on Le Menagier by a poulterer?
>
>Further support for this theory can be found in the following: "Hares
>rarely live more than a year in the wild."
>[ http://animaldiversity.ummz.umich.edu/accounts/lepus/
>l._capensis$narrative.html ]
>
>I found a table of life expectancies for various mammals which pretty much
>confirmed this - life expectancy at birth was 1.12 years for a European
>Hare.
